The Indianapolis Colts find themselves in the midst of an intriguing contest for the quarterback position, and we are now seeing the initial significant developments. According to comments from head coach Shane Steichen, Anthony Richardson is slated to commence the preseason game against the Ravens on Thursday at 7 p.m. Eastern Time, while Daniel Jones is scheduled to start Week 2’s 1 p.m. contest against the Packers at their home venue.

Both Richardson and Jones were jointly designated as QB1s on the Colts’ initial depth chart this past Monday. There may be a heightened sense of urgency within the organization to facilitate a positive turnaround in Richardson’s trajectory, which has been impacted by recurring injuries and inconsistent performance, including a shoulder ailment that has been a factor during the current summer period. Richardson was selected as the fourth overall pick in the 2023 NFL Draft, and the Colts made a calculated decision based on his potential rather than demonstrated results. To date, the outcome has not fully met their initial expectations.

Indianapolis made a substantial investment in Jones, surpassing the typical allocation for a backup player, by securing him with a one-year arrangement that reportedly includes a $6 million signing bonus and $7.15 million in guaranteed compensation, along with the potential for additional millions through performance-based escalators. Consequently, considerable expectations have been placed on Richardson.

The time has come to assess whether Richardson or Jones (or possibly both) can deliver on their potential.

  • Micah Parsons Continues Absence: Cowboys owner Jerry Jones communicated to reporters on Tuesday that he lacks certainty regarding Parsons’ availability for Week 1 but emphasized the importance of reaching a resolution. However, Jones confirmed that neither he nor any team officials have engaged with Parsons’ representative to deliberate a new contract since his trade request emerged.

  • Kyren Williams and Rams Finalize Agreement: Running back Kyren Williams and the Los Angeles Rams have reached a new understanding, reportedly spanning three years with a value of $33 million, including $23 million in guaranteed funds. Williams had consistently participated in practices with the Rams, and one of the most closely observed contract situations in the NFL has now been addressed.
